Gov. Jeff Landry Signs Executive Order Protecting Ratepayers from AI Data Center Costs

Louisiana Governor Jeff Landry signed an executive order on June 26, 2026, to shield electricity ratepayers from costs tied to AI data centers.

On June 26, 2026, Louisiana Governor Jeff Landry signed an executive order designed to protect ratepayers from potential cost increases associated with AI data center developments. The regulatory action addresses concerns over the impact of large-scale data center projects on utility rates in the state.
